Publicly available information regarding land and buildings within the geographical boundaries of Kitsap County, Washington, forms a comprehensive database. This resource includes details such as ownership history, assessed value, legal descriptions, tax information, and recorded documents like deeds and liens. A typical example might be the record of a single-family home, showing its current owner, purchase date, lot size, building dimensions, and any outstanding mortgages.

Access to this data offers significant advantages for various purposes. Potential homebuyers can research property values and histories, facilitating informed purchasing decisions. Current owners can verify their property details and track assessed values. Legal professionals, researchers, and investors utilize these records for due diligence, market analysis, and historical research. The accurate and transparent maintenance of these records contributes to fair market practices and a secure system of land ownership, rooted in the historical practice of recording land transactions to prevent disputes and ensure clear title.
